列表

详情


在计算机系统中,以下关于高速缓存 (Cache) 的说法正确的是(  )。

A. Cache的容量通常大于主存的存储容量

B. 通常由程序员设置Cache的内容和访问速度

C. Cache 的内容是主存内容的副本

D. 多级Cache 仅在多核CPU中使用

参考答案: C

详细解析:

高速缓存是用来存放当前最活跃的程序和数据的,作为主存局部域的副本,其特点是:容量一般在几KB到几MB之间;速度一般比主存快5到10倍,由快速半导体存储器构成;其内容是主存局部域的副本,对程序员来说是透明的。

高速缓存的组成如下图所示:Cache由两部分组成:控制部分和Cache部分。Cache部分用来存放主存的部分拷贝(副本)信息。控制部分的功能是:判断CPU要访问的信息是否在Cache中,若在即为命中,若不在则没有命中。命中时直接对Cache存储器寻址。未命中时,要按照替换原则,决定主存的一块信息放到Cache的哪一块里面。


上一题